ptyfwd: optionally prefix window title with colored dot
in uid0/systemd-run/nspawn we already set a window title with a colorful
unicode dot indicating the changed privileges/execution context. This typically
gets overriden by the shell inside the environment however.
Let's tweak this a bit: when we see the window title OSC ANSI sequence
passing through, let's patch in the unicode dot as a prefix to the
title.
This is super pretty, since it makes sure root sessions via 0ad are
really easily recognizable as such, because the window title carries an
🔴 red dot as prefix then.
By default swtpm runs with four banks: SHA1, SHA256, SHA384, SHA512.
This means all data that is part of the boot will be hashed four times,
which slows everything down.
Let's restrict things to SHA256 only, which is the one that really
matters. SHA1 is no up to today's standards anyway, and noone really
consumes the other two, hence no point in enabling this.
To disable the banks we need to call swtpm_setup with --pcr-banks. Do
so.
TPM 1.2 is obsolete, and doesn't really provide much security guarantees
given it's build around SHA1 which is not up to today's standards.
The rest of systemd's TPM codebase never supported TPM 1.2 hence let's
drop this partial support in sd-stub too. It has created problems after
all (sd-stub reported the measuements and userspace assumed these were
for TPM2), without bringing any benefits (given that the measurements we
make are not consumed by us anyway, unlike those for TPM 2.0)

Max Staudt [Thu, 22 Feb 2024 08:47:36 +0000 (17:47 +0900)]
udev: Add /dev/media/by-path symlinks for media controllers
Add persistent symlinks for media controller ("mediaX") devices, based
on their ID_PATH udev properties.
For example, if the uvcvideo driver creates /dev/media0, a persistent
name may be:
/dev/media/by-path/pci-0000:04:00.3-usb-0:1:1.0-media-controller
Persistent links are a handy tool to make scripts self-documenting
during development or in tests, as well as less error prone in case of
devices changing enumeration order. For media controllers, one can
alternatively scan through all of them and look for a matching bus_info
in their struct media_device_info, but the links are much handier when
drafting something by hand.
A similar pattern already exists for Video4Linux /dev/videoX devices,
see 60-persistent-v4l.rules for those.
Yu Watanabe [Tue, 20 Feb 2024 21:20:45 +0000 (06:20 +0900)]
network: introduce per-interface IP forwarding settings
This deprecates IPForward= setting, which unconditionally controled
the global setting, even though it is a setting in .network file.
Instead, this introduces new IPv4Forwarding= and IPv6Forwarding=
settings both in .network and networkd.conf.
If these settings are specified in a .network file, then the
per-interface forwarding setting will be configured.
If specified in networkd.conf, then the global IP forwarding setting will
be configured.

test-ukify: skip signing in tests when slow tests are disabled
I have a large initrd (built with mkosi-initrd) and the test-ukify takes 30 s.
Let's use the usual approach of skipping the slowests tests.
(pytest has marks, and it would be nicer to mark tests with pytest.mark.slow,
and then use "-m 'not slow'" in the meson test invocation. But markers must be
pre-registered, otherwise pytest emits a warning. There are a few ways to
register markers, but they all require "project configuration", but because of
how we invoke pytest, this is hard to do. So let's just use an environment
variable.)
Susant Sahani [Tue, 20 Feb 2024 13:12:20 +0000 (18:42 +0530)]
netdev/macvlan: allow to set the broadcast queueing threshold
Allow to set the broadcast queueing threshold
on macvlan devices. This controls which multicast packets will be
processed in a workqueue instead of inline.

tree-wide: be more careful when passing literal integers to "t" bus message fields
Since we use varargs for sd_message_append() we need to make sure the
parameters we pass are actually 64bit wide, if "t" is used. Hence cast
appropriately if necessary.
I went through the whole tree, and in most cases we got it right, but
there are some cases we missed so far.
vmspawn: rename "qemu" specific switches to not carry the "qemu" prefix
This renames a few of the switches vmspawn takes, such as --qemu-mem=
and --qemu-smp= to names without the "qemu" moniker and uses less
cryptic names (i.e. --ram= and --cpus=).
I think it's a bit unsystematic that so far we use the "qemu" prefix for
some options but not for others. At least I could not figure out a
system when we use it and when we don't. Hence let's clean it up and
just use simpler names without suffix.
After all we might want to plug other hypervisors behind vmspawn one
day, hence I think there's value in sticking to generic names for these
switches that allow us to switch out backends easily. In particular for
--ram= and --cpus= which are probably the most fundamental of VM settings
there are.
The old switches are support for compat, but not advertised in man page
or --help text anymore.
I left "--qemu-gui" under its current name, since it fundamentally is a
a qemu concept, exposing a qemu specific graphical UI.

bsod: add new option --tty= to specify TTY to output on
If specified we'll not try to find a free V, but instead just output
directly to the specified TTY. This is particularly useful for
debugging, as it means "systemd-bsod --tty=/dev/tty" just works.

Daan De Meyer [Fri, 16 Feb 2024 15:58:58 +0000 (16:58 +0100)]
meson: Decouple the version tag from the vcs tag
Let's split off a new vcs-tag option from version-tag that configures whether
the current commit should be appended to the version tag. Doing this saves
us from having to fiddle around with generating git versions in packaging
specs and instead let's meson do it for us, even if we pass in a custom
version tag.
With this approach there's no more need for tools/meson-vcs-tag.sh so
we remove it.
We have a number of components these days that are split into multiple
binaries, i.e. a primary one, and a worker callout usually. These
binaries are closely related, they typically speak a protocol that is
internal, and not safe to mix and match. Examples for this:
- homed and its worker binary homework
- userdbd and its worker binary userwork
- import and the various pull/import/export handlers
- sysupdate the same
- the service manager and the executor binary
Running any of these daemons directly from the meson build tree is
messy, since the implementations will typically invoke the installed
callout binaries, not the ones from the build tree. This is very
annoying, and not obvious at first.
Now, we could always invoke relevant binaries from $(dirname
/proc/self/exe) first, before using the OS installed ones. But that's
typically not what is desired, because this means in the installed case
(i.e. the usual one) we'll look for these callout binaries at a place
they typically will not be found (because these callouts generally are
located in libexecdir, not bindir when installed).
Hence, let's try to do things a bit smarter, and follow what build
systems such as meson have already been doing to make sure dynamic
library discovery works correctly when binaries are run from a build
directory: let's start looking at rpath/runpath in the main binary that
is executed: if there's an rpath/runpath set, then we'll look for the
callout binaries next to the main binary, otherwise we won't. This
should generally be the right thing to do as meson strips the rpath
during installation, and thus we'll look for the callouts in the build
dir if in build dir mode, and in the OS otherwise.
